We are using 2 access versions on 1 pc. One is a full installation of access 97, one a runtime version of Access 2003. All databases on the pc are access 97, except for 1.
The problem is: Access automatically sets the last used version as it's default.
We were trying to work around this by adding the version to use in a shortcut for the 2003-database.When it is closed, access quickly starts an instance of 97 so that this becomes the default again.
Now our main problem: the system.mdw resets every time access 97 is reset as the default. We have a system.mdw on our network. We enter this in the workgroup administrator.
We open the access 97 database, it asks for a password (good)
We then open the 2003 database, it still asks a password (good)
We then open the access 97 database again, and we don't need a password anymore and are logged in as admin. In the workgroup administrator, we see that the workgroup is reset again to the default one (in the windows folder I believe)
Any ideas on how to overcome this, because we are starting to get a little frustrated with this problem...
